Effective Leadership Practices

LEADERSHIP which produces change, often to a dramatic degree
& MANAGEMENT which produces a degree of predictability, consistency & order.
(Kotter)

LEADERSHIP and MANAGEMENT
- Establishing direction Planning & Budgetting
- Aligning people Organising & Staffing
- Motivating & Inspiring Controlling & Problem solving
(Kotter)

- Challenging the status quo
- Inspiring a shared vision
- Encouraging the heart
- Modelling the way
- Enabling others to act
plus a willingness to take prudent business risks.
(Kouzes and Posner)
